Course structure

• Introduction to Playwriting and Wellbeing: Foundations and Connections
• The Role of Storytelling in Mental Health and Emotional Resilience
• Crafting Characters for Therapeutic Impact
• Writing Dialogue that Heals and Connects
• Structuring Plays for Emotional Engagement and Catharsis
• Incorporating Mindfulness and Self-Reflection into Playwriting
• Using Playwriting to Address Trauma and Foster Recovery
• Collaborative Playwriting: Building Community Through Shared Stories
• Staging and Performance: Bringing Wellbeing-Focused Plays to Life
• Ethical Considerations in Playwriting for Wellbeing

Career path

Theatre Playwright: Craft compelling scripts for theatre productions, blending storytelling with wellbeing themes to engage audiences.

Creative Writing Facilitator: Lead workshops that use creative writing as a tool for personal growth and mental health improvement.

Wellbeing Workshop Leader: Design and deliver workshops focused on using playwriting techniques to enhance emotional resilience.

Arts in Health Practitioner: Integrate playwriting into healthcare settings to support patient recovery and wellbeing.

Drama Therapist: Use playwriting and drama techniques to help individuals explore emotions and improve mental health.
